  5. demand, claim, require imply making an authoritative request. To demand is to ask in a bold, authoritative way: to demand an explanation. To claim is to assert a right to something: He claimed it as his due. To require is to ask for something as being necessary; to compel: The Army requires absolute obedience of its soldiers.

  11. Demand is a description of all quantities of a good or service that a buyer would be willing to purchase at all prices. According to the law of demand, this relationship is always negative: the response to an increase in price is a decrease in the quantity demanded.
